The band is back on stage with their first new studio album since 2013’s Kveikur. Sigur Rós founding members Jónsi and Georg Holm are joined in the studio and on tour by former member Kjartan Sveinsson, who is rejoining the band almost a decade after stepping away to focus on other projects. They will air new songs at the shows, alongside material drawn from the band's acclaimed 25-year discography.
